AUCs and optimal cutoff values of different indices from ROC analyses of IL-2, IL-4, and IFN-γ for the determination of GGO (see Figure 1).
| Variable | AUC | 95%CI | Sensitivity | Specificity | Optimal cutoff (pg/mL) | |
|---|---|---|---|---|---|---|
| IL-2 | 0.716 | 0.569-0.864 | 0.538 | 0.875 | 3.205 | |
| IL-4 | 0.689 | 0.549-0.829 | 0.487 | 0.875 | 3.175 | |
| IFN-γ | 0.696 | 0.525-0.868 | 0.897 | 0.375 | 1.875 |
AUC: area under the curve; CI: confidence interval.

Multivariate logistic regression analysis of 3 bi-categorical variables for the determination of GGO.
| Variable | Cutoff value | OR (95%CI) | P-value |
|---|---|---|---|
| IL-2 (pg/mL) | >3.205 | 8.167 (1.633- 40.848) | 0.011 |
| IL-4 (pg/mL) | >1.875 | 2.625 (1.106-32.537) | 0.218 |
| IFN-γ (pg/mL) | >3.175 | 3.864 (0.489-30.531) | 0.200 |
OR: odds ratio; CI: confidence interval
